Su Sha is a scholar working on Sensory Systems, Molecular Biology and Immunology. According to data from OpenAlex, Su Sha has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 305 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Sensory Systems, 3 papers in Molecular Biology and 2 papers in Immunology. Recurrent topics in Su Sha’s work include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(4 papers), Immune Response and Inflammation (2 papers) and Vestibular and auditory disorders (2 papers). Su Sha is often cited by papers focused on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(4 papers), Immune Response and Inflammation (2 papers) and Vestibular and auditory disorders (2 papers). Su Sha collaborates with scholars based in United States, Poland and China. Su Sha's co-authors include Jochen Schacht, Xiaodong Wang, Kevin D. Hill, Hao Yuan, Fuquan Chen, Naoki Oishi, J. Samson, Piotr Politański, Adam Dudarewicz and Mariola Śliwińska‐Kowalska and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Neuroscience, PLoS ONE and Neuroscience.
